All posts

Troubleshooting Collaboration gRPC Errors: A Systematic Approach to Preventing Production Failures

The logs didn’t lie. At 2:14 a.m., your collaboration service crashed under a wall of gRPC errors. Everything stopped. No commits synced. No messages sent. Just silence, except for the blinking cursor on your terminal. gRPC is built for speed, yet small cracks in configuration, networking, or proto definitions can trigger cascading failures. A “Collaboration gRPC error” isn’t always one thing—it’s a family of failures that behave unpredictably under load. The fix is never guesswork. Most cases

Free White Paper

Customer Support Access to Production + gRPC Security: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

The logs didn’t lie. At 2:14 a.m., your collaboration service crashed under a wall of gRPC errors. Everything stopped. No commits synced. No messages sent. Just silence, except for the blinking cursor on your terminal.

gRPC is built for speed, yet small cracks in configuration, networking, or proto definitions can trigger cascading failures. A “Collaboration gRPC error” isn’t always one thing—it’s a family of failures that behave unpredictably under load. The fix is never guesswork.

Most cases trace back to four main issues:

Continue reading? Get the full guide.

Customer Support Access to Production + gRPC Security: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.
  • Mismatched protobuf contracts between client and server, causing method or field errors
  • Deadline and timeout misconfiguration leading to incomplete or hung requests
  • Connection instability from DNS, firewall, or TLS handshake failures
  • Message size limits silently breaking transfers during real-time sync

Each of these can appear benign in development but detonate in production. Latency spikes magnify the pain. Retries multiply connection churn. Your collaboration tools become unreliable at the exact moment your team needs them most.

Solving it demands a repeatable process. Start with precise logging across both ends of the gRPC stream. Instrument deadlines to match real-world needs, not just test values. Audit every part of your environment—certificates, proxies, load balancers—for configuration drift. Validate protobuf compatibility on every deploy. And when fixes roll out, test under real concurrency, not synthetic single-request checks.

The biggest mistake? Treating collaboration gRPC errors as isolated bugs instead of systemic signals. They’re often the canary for deeper issues—architectural mismatches, flawed service boundaries, or missing observability. Once you see them as symptoms, you can build systems that resist them instead of chasing endless patches.

And here’s where speed matters. You don’t fix issues like this by waiting for the next roadmap sprint. You need environments to test and prove changes now. That’s why teams are spinning up real, production-like setups with hoop.dev—turning ideas into live, testable systems in minutes, not days. See it for yourself, connect your pipeline, and catch these errors before they reach your users.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ts